This georeferenced RGB image represents 2 meter resolution bathymetry of the southwest shore of Puerto Rico (La Parguera). NOAA's NOS/NCCOS/CCMA Biogeography Team, in collaboration with NOAA vessel Nancy Foster and territory, federal, and private sector partners, acquired multibeam bathymetry data in the US Virgin Islands and Puerto Rico from 3/21/06 to 4/2/06. Data was acquired with a hull-mounted Kongsberg Simrad EM 1002 multibeam echosounder (95 kHz) and process NOAA contractor using CARIS HIPS software. Data has all correctors applied (attitude, sound velocity) and has been reduced to mean lower low water (MLLW) using final approved tides and zoning from NOAA COOPS. Data is in UTM zone 19 north, datum WGS84. The processed CARIS data was used to generate a CARIS BASE image surface based on swath angle. The project was conducted to meet IHO Order 1 and 2 accuracy standards, dependant on the project area and depth. The National Oceanic and Atmospheric Administration (NOAA) has the statutory mandate to collect hydrographic data in support of nautical chart compilation for safe navigation and to provide background data for engineers, scientific, and other commercial and industrial activities. Hydrographic survey data primarily consist of water depths, but may also include features (e.g. rocks, wrecks), navigation aids, shoreline identification, and bottom type information. NOAA is responsible for archiving and distributing the source data as described in this metadata record.

CRED Subsurface Temperature Recorder (STR); Wake Atoll, Pacific Remote Island Areas; Long: 166.62866, Lat: 19.28027 (WGS84); Sensor Depth: 12.80m; Data Date Range: 20090324-20110325.
Vydavatel National Oceanic and Atmospheric Administration, Department of Commerce
Datum vydání před více než 9 roky
Shrnutí
Popis
Data from Coral Reef Ecosystem Division (CRED), NOAA Pacific Islands Fisheries Science Center (PIFSC) Subsurface Temperature Recorders (STR) provide a time series of water temperature at coral reef sites. Data is typically collected at 1800 second intervals for a duration of 2 years using a SBE39 Temperature Recorder (Sea-Bird Electronics, Inc., www.seabird.com). When a STR is recovered, a new one is typically deployed in the same place. Time series data combining multiple deployments from a given site may also be available. Physical and underway data collected aboard the ATLANTIS during cruise AT15-26 in the North Pacific Ocean from 2007-11-13 to 2007-12-03 (NODC Accession 0113820)

NODC accession 0113820 includes physical and underway data collected aboard the ATLANTIS during cruise AT15-26 in the North Pacific Ocean from 2007-11-13 to 2007-12-03. These data include CURRENT SPEED - EAST/WEST COMPONENT (U) and CURRENT SPEED - NORTH/SOUTH COMPONENT (V). The instruments used to collect these data include ADCP and GPS. These data were collected by Lauren Mullineaux of Woods Hole Oceanographic Institution as part of Oceanographic and Topographic Influences on Dispersal of Hydrothermal Vent Species. The Lamont-Doherty Earth Observatory (LDEO) submitted these data to NODC as part of the NSF sponsored Rolling Deck to Repository (R2R) program. The ADCP data represent the raw and automated processed data set. Post processed quality assessed data are not available in this accession.

CRED REA Algal Assessments, Maui and Molokini Islet, Main Hawaiian Islands, 2005 (NODC Accession 0010352)

Twelve quadrats were sampled along 2 consecutively-placed, 25m transect lines as part of Rapid Ecological Assessments conducted at 9 sites at Maui Island and 3 sites at Molokini Islet in the Main Hawaiian Islands in February and July 2005 from the NOAA vessels Oscar Elton Sette (OES05-02) and Hi'ialakai (HI05-05). Raw survey data included genus presence and relative abundance, and voucher specimens. Detailed taxonomic analyses of voucher specimens are presented.

Temperature profile data from STD/CTD casts from the KNORR from a world-wide distribution during the International Decade of Ocean Exploration / Geochemical Ocean Section Study (IDOE/GEOSECS) project, 24 July 1972 - 09 June 1974 (NODC Accession 8200010)

Temperature and salinity profile data were collected using STD/CTD casts from KNORR in a world-wide distribution from July 24, 1972 to June 9, 1974. Data were submitted by Scripps Institution of Oceanography as part of the International Decade of Ocean Exploration / Geochemical Ocean Section Study (IDOE/GEOSECS) project. Data were processed by NODC to the NODC standard High-Resolution STD/CTD Data (F022) format. Full F022 format description is available at http://www.nodc.noaa.gov/General/NODC-Archive/f022.html. The F022 format contains high-resolution data collected using CTD (conductivity-temperature-depth) and STD (salinity-temperature-depth) instruments. As they are lowered and raised in the oceans, these electronic devices provide nearly continuous profiles of temperature, salinity, and other parameters. Data values may be subject to averaging or filtering or obtained by interpolation and may be reported at depth intervals as fine as 1m. Cruise and instrument information, position, date, time and sampling interval are reported for each station. Environmental data at the time of the cast (meteorological and sea surface conditions) may also be reported. The data record comprises values of temperature, salinity or conductivity, density (computed sigma-t), and possibly dissolved oxygen or transmissivity at specified depth or pressure levels. Data may be reported at either equally or unequally spaced depth or pressure intervals. A text record is available for comments.
